Abstract : ABSTRACT In this study, Blends of SBR and NBR were prepared on a two roll mill, and different compositions of boron carbide particles were added to it. Cure characteristics of all samples were studied. Tensile, tear and hardness tests were conducted, according to ASTM standards. Increasing trend was obtained for each of the mentioned properties, with the addition of the filler. Change in hardness is found to be acceptable. Better enhancement obtained for tensile strength and tear strength. Percentage elongation in both tests were note and elastic modulus values also found for all samples. The enhancement in properties were compared with the specific gravity change of the rubber compound.
